Description of problem: Post installation of lohit-marathi-fonts in mr_IN.UTF-8 (default) locale; font configuration <*.conf> levelling of lohit-marathi-fonts should have precedence over lohit-devanagari-fonts.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): lohit-devanagari-fonts-2.94.0-2.fc21 How re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. Perform default installation in Marathi (mr_IN.UTF-8) locale 2. Install lohit-marathi-fonts Actual results: font configuration <*.conf> levelling of lohit-marathi-fonts is low as compared to lohit-devanagari-fonts Expected results: font configuration <*.conf> levelling of lohit-marathi-fonts should gain precedence over lohit-devanagari-fonts Additional info: lohit-marathi-fonts have customized 'mr' glyph(s) as compared to lohit-devangari-fonts. Incorrect <*.conf> levelling of lohit-marathi-fonts over lohit-devanagari-fonts affects rendering of 'mr' content directly.
